Bharna Kheda Population - Vidisha, Madhya Pradesh

Bharna Kheda is a medium size village located in Shamshabad Tehsil of Vidisha district, Madhya Pradesh with total 212 families residing. The Bharna Kheda village has population of 1050 of which 577 are males while 473 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bharna Kheda village population of children with age 0-6 is 186 which makes up 17.71 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bharna Kheda village is 820 which is lower than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Bharna Kheda as per census is 738, lower than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Bharna Kheda village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Bharna Kheda village was 61.34 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Bharna Kheda Male literacy stands at 74.04 % while female literacy rate was 46.19 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 10.48 % of total population in Bharna Kheda village. The village Bharna Kheda curr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Bharna Kheda village out of total population, 354 were engaged in work activities. 44.92 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 55.08 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 354 workers engaged in Main Work, 143 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 7 were Agricultural labourer.
